The reason why Playboy failed were from multiple factors. #1 promises were made by local politicians to run thru a casino license for them and they didn't come through for them. The game room was constructed for that purpose with all the infrastructure installed. All they had to do was to bring in the tables and slots. #2 People forget about how Hefner's partner was skimming off the top from their other casino's. They we're losing 2 mil a month just at The Brittania in the Paradise island. After that the various entities that bought used it as a write off and then Mulvahill totally screwed with his time shares. My entire family worked there in all different departments and my Mom was eventually their auditor.

I Worked There In 1974 When I Was A Sr. In High School Evenings And Weekends In Housekeeping Stocking The Maid Closets East And West Wings. One Wing Had 8 Floors And One Had 7 Floors. The Roof And Outside End Wall Always Leaked On The West Wing Because That Whole Wing Was Sinking Into The Ground Even Back Then . It Was A Terribly Built Structure. I Still Have My Last Pay Check Stub And Union Dues Book Hotel Restaurant And Bartender Workers Union . I Started At 2.25 Per Hr. And Then Got 2.45. Per Hour. My Biggest Weekly Net Pay Was Around $ 90.00 . I Could Tell You Stories About All Kinds Of Things I Saw And Heard Going On . I Was Like A Fly On The Wall.
